Kentucky Derby (G1) points are up for grabs in two stakes races on March 22: the  $777,000 JEFF RUBY STEAKS (G3)  at Turfway Park in Florence, KY, which is at 1 1/8 miles on the Tapeta surface and the $1 million LOUISIANA DERBY (G2) at Fair Grounds  in New Orleans, LA at 1 1/8 miles on dirt.

Those two cards of racing are loaded with stakes events including the Bourbonette Oaks and Fair Grounds Oaks (G2), which offer Kentucky Oaks (G1) points.

Canadian horsepeople are represented at both tracks. In particular, JOSIE CARROLL will start the DiScola Boys’ HE’S NOT JOKING in the Jeff Ruby, hoping that the switch back to synthetic dirt will get the Kentucky-bred colt back in form. The son of Practical Joke won the Grade 3 Grey stakes at Woodbine on Tapeta last year but has been well beaten in the Grade 2 Kentucky Jockey Club Stakes on Nov. 30 and Grade 3 Holy Bull Stakes at Gulfstream on Feb. 1.
